Mr Punch's Delight at Finding His Dear Old Puppets where He Left Them in July', 1865. As the new Session of Parliament is about to commence, Mr Punch retrieves all his favourite toys Lord Derby, Mr Speaker, et al from his Houses of Parliament toybox. From Punch, or the London Charivari, February 11, 1865.
